Course Code: BS-103L    Course Name: Chemistry Lab

MODULE NO / UNIT COURSE SYLLABUS CONTENTS OF MODULE NOTES
1 LIST OF EXPERIMENTS
1. To Determine the surface tension of a given liquid
2. To determine the relative viscosity of a given liquid using Ostwald’s viscometer
3. To identify the number of components present in a given organic mixture by thin layer chromatography
4. To determine the alkalinity of a given water sample
5. Determination of the strength of a given HCl solution by titrating it with standard NaOH solution using conductometer
6. Synthesis of a drug (paracetamol/Aspirin)
7. Determination of chloride content of a given water sample
8. To determine the calcium & magnesium or temporary & permanent hardness of a given water sample by EDTA method
9. To determine the total iron content present in a given iron ore solution by redox titration
10. Determination of the partition coefficient of a substance between two immiscible liquids
11. To find out the content of sodium, potassium in a given salt solution by Flame Photometer
12. To find out the λmax and concentration of unknown solution by a spectrophotometer
13. To find out the flash point and fire point of the given oil sample by Pensky Martin apparatus
14. To determine the amount of dissolved oxygen present in a given water sample
15. To find out the pour point and cloud point of a lubricating oil
16. Determination of the strength of a given HCl solution by titrating it with standard NaOH solution using pH meter
17. Using Redwood Viscometer find out the viscosity of an oil sample
Note: At Least 9 experiments to be performed from the list .
